I work for United Parcel Service (UPS). You know, the big brown trucks that deliver packages incase you didn't know.
Recently, our building has been greatly understaffed. Most of us are maxing out our DOT hours. We're bringing back packages undelivered due to this.
Usually when we can't deliver packages due to running out DOT hours, we scan the package as "missed". This tells the customer that we weren't able to deliver it today for many different reasons such as running out of time, or it was loaded onto the wrong truck by mistake in a different area etc etc.
When we can't deliver a package due to weather, we scan the package as "EC" or known as emergency condition.
The difference between missed and EC is missed is our fault. EC is in a way out of our control (unsafe to deliver such as a snowy driveway, closed road).
Due to a lot of drivers maxing out their 14 hour daily DOT limit, thousands of packages are coming back undelivered. We're being instructed not to scan it missed and that the company will scan it themselves. I later learned that they are scanning it with some sort of weather scan. It's to my understanding this weather scan makes it so the company isn't at fault.
The reason why I find this possibly fraud is because people who pay extra money for overnight shipping, two day shipping, etc etc would normally get a refund due to us missing the deadline for the expedite shipping. It's to my understanding when the company scans it as weather related, they now don't owe a refund. If it was scanned correctly as missed, they would owe a refund.
Is this a billion dollar fraud? No, but I find this very wrong. One of the few ways to get fired at UPS is being dishonest. They'll fire you immediately for scanning anything dishonestly and knowingly. Yet they are doing it and saving themselves from paying out refunds that are owed to the customer. I have no idea what dollar amount this would add up to, but if you've ever shipped something overnight than you would know it's not cheap and could add up quick when you're talking about thousands of packages over a couple of months.
